Every year, the Rychko family gathers their large family in their native village of Kyrnasivtsi in the Tulchyn community to treat everyone to home-made buckwheat porridge. This event takes place on the eve of Christmas, so the whole process is accompanied by carols, singing, and family entertainment. During this process, the Rychko brothers, who are only four, slaughter a pig, sing with the Berehynya vocal group on carts, and play out the theft of a cauldron of buckwheat porridge by a devil. Folk tales are brought to life around the campfire, and local villagers are happy to watch every stage of the Christmas fun.
